Hands on and interactive, don’t miss our very special Science Stroll this February Vacation, coming to the Cape Cod Museum of Natural History on Tuesday, February 17, 2026 from 10:30am – 2pm.  The event is free with admission.

Take a journey across land, sea and air with Museum volunteers in our auditorium. Budding explorers will get to peer through microscopes, conduct their own experiments and build their own craft projects to take home!
It’s an action-packed program for any child with an interest in how the world they live in really works, including:
• See through a horseshoe crab’s eyes, and watch baby horseshoe crabs swim.
• Explore marine food webs from plankton to whales
• Plant seeds to start your own wildflower garden.
• Do a beachcombing scavenger hunt to earn a prize.
• Make a butterfly to take home as you learn about pollinators.
• Craft 3D Acorn People while you learn about mighty oaks.
• Create colorful art from leaf-rubbing.
